Rank: ILN Officer  
Rank: ILN Officer  


Role: The ILN Officer is any pilot in the University who has decided to dedicate themeselves in defending the ILN and the University, and has passed the [[Joining the ILN|Officer Advancement Process]]. An ILN Officer is responsible for providing a continual flow of information, training, and practical fleet experience&nbsp;to their fellow ILN Officers, as well as the University. To accomlish that, ILN&nbsp;Officers are required to serve as either a Squad Commander, Wing Commander, Fleet Commander or Scout&nbsp;a minimum of three times per month. An ILN&nbsp;Officer may also choose to instruct fellow ILN Officers and University members in a PVP-focused class or training session a minimum of three times per month. ILN Officers are not only permitted, but encouraged, to have provide any combination of fleet&nbsp;and class training, provided they meet the minimum standards. There is no maximum limit to how often an ILN&nbsp;Officer gives back to their community. The ILN Officer is used to develop the leadership skills of up-and-coming fleet commanders within the ILN&nbsp;under the watchful eyes of the&nbsp;ILN Staff&nbsp;Officers&nbsp;(CO, XO and Liaison Officers).&nbsp;<br>
